Summary:

 

Assist the Site Administrator with the day-to-day operations of the medical department, while still serving in the medical healthcare provider role.

 

Primary Duties and Responsibilities:

 

  • Manage all inquiries with regards to information, referral, and/or possible admission
  • Conduct pre-admission screenings of potential clients for detoxification services
  • Schedule detoxification admissions/discharges to detoxification and residential programs, including completion of all required medical documents
  • Review all detoxification protocol applications
  • Verification that medical charts have been closed properly
  • Provide coverage for call-off’s and no-show’s
  • Conduct ADIA admissions/discharge for detoxification clients
  • Create monthly medical staff schedule
  • Schedule monthly team meeting with the Physician’s Assistant and/or Medical Director
  • Conduct staff training for new medical employees and notify current employees of any changes in day-to-day procedures
  • Prepare order and inventory of medical supplies with assistance of medical staff
  • Take appropriate action as directed by Medical Director to ensure clients medical stability and in cases emergency facilitate assistance per Harbor Light protocol
  • Assist Medical Director, Physician’s Assistant, and/or designate in the provision of medical services
  • Ensure all records, charts, logs and all other pertinent data for medical unit are maintained on a daily basis

Qualifications:

  • Must have and maintain a current valid Practical Nurse (PN) or Registered Nurse (RN) license.
  • Experience in substance abuse preferred.

The Salvation Army offers the following benefits:

  • Health Care Benefits which include:
    • Medical
    • Dental
    • Vision
    • Hearing
    • Flexible spending accounts
    • AFLAC
    • Voluntary life insurance benefits
  • Short-Term and Long-Term Disability options
  • Pet Insurance
  • Pension contributions (currently 6.0% of your earnings) begin the first quarter after 1 year of employment.
    • Vesting starts after three years of employment, 100% vested after five years of employment
  • The Salvation Army also offers a 403(b) voluntary retirement savings plan in which you may participate immediately, with approved vendors. There is currently no organizational match for 403(b) contributions.
  • Employee Discounts
  • Paid Time Off which includes:
    • Up to (6) earned sick days per year may be used as discretionary days.
    • The accrual rate is based upon years of service and approved hours worked.
    • Sick days begin accruing the first of the month after one full calendar month after employment begins, and you may begin to use sick days after (90) days of employment. 
    • Vacation begins accruing the first of the month after one full calendar month after employment begins, and you may begin to use vacation days after (90) days of employment. 
    • You will receive up to 2 personal days per year based on date of hire.
    • Birthday off with pay.  
    • Paid holidays are effective immediately.
